HDL is the vehicle for reversed cholesterol transport and estrification, serving as a scavenger for free cholesterol during intravascular catabolism of lipoproteins. HDL levels are inversely correlated with coronary heart disease. In a normal fasting individual, HDL concentrations range from 1.0-2.0 g/L.
